One word.

Opalec.

Makes the mini a nice regulated white and gets 10+ hours out of a set of AA's. Best thing that ever happened to a mini.

The little red "Batt Signal" /ubbthreads/images/graemlins/wink.gif that comes on to let you know that that beautiful white LED light will start to dim if it doesn't get new AA's is neat, too. If you are like me (and I suspect a lot of us) you'll either try to find a worn set of AA's or run some down just to see it. /ubbthreads/images/graemlins/smile.gif

Of course there are a lot of other good things that fit the mini, the BB400 is one fine example, but the Opalec Newbeam fits in so well when just the right amount of always-the-same-white-light is needed.

I have an Arc LS2, but before I'd consider an Arc LS with a 2AA battery pack, I'd convert one of those useless Mag 2AA's to a BadBoy500. Add a glass lens and a Kroll tailswitch and you have a most wonderful light. Brighter than an Opalec, though those are nice and have their place as well. The Arc LS series is great because of its size. IMHO, once you do the 2AA thing, you lose the magic of it. - Lee

/ubbthreads/images/graemlins/smile.gifGinseng you will realy like your ultra.Here is a tip for the pocket clip, my clio slipped alot on the slick body so I put a layer of 2 sided carpet tape inside the clip trimed the tape flush with the clip and then worked it back on the light.The clip no longer moves when put on a hat brim or collar and the tape does not show.I used the thinist tape i could find.
